Hello - I have a 72 Evinrude 9.9 that is stuck in Forward. Great little motor, starts right up and runs like a champ, but I can't get it out of gear. It used to be sticky moving from FWD to Neutral to Reverse but now it won't move at all - any suggestions?

Have you taken the time to drain and refill the lower unit ??-----------There are some expensive parts in there and if you are running with water in there then ?????
 
Consider this...if you are running steel bearings and other steel parts in water instead of oil, what happens to the steel? Yup, it rusts, and seizes.
 
So, drain and refill the oil in the gearcase. Not a big deal to do, and at least you will know if that is the trouble.
 
If water in there..will need service...usually not a big deal on the smaller motors, depends whats needed. Seals, O rings, etc. And a water pump. Let us know what you find when you drain it.
 
What is the model # of this motor ??----------It should be easy to shift to nuetral if it is not running.-------Sounds like linkages may have been tampered with !!------May not even be connected to the lower unit.---Amazing things happen when folks start to work on motors.
